This is an old revision of the document!


This is an advanced module


This module allows users to integrate with a SOAP webservice integration from within the application.

Its functionality is similar to the REST ( ) module, but using the SOAP specification. Unlike REST, SOAP is fully discoverable. With REST, users must know precisely what information the the webservice should return. Conversely, with SOAP, users can essentially send a list of required information and the webservice will be able to return that information.


The SOAP module has four different input sections.
WSDL URL: Enter the WSDL for the desired SOAP webservice. Click the refresh icon to load the WSDL methods for the webservice in the module.
SOAP Version: This indicates the SOAP version for the selected webservice. Options include SOAP 1.1 or SOAP 1.2.
Method: Drop-down menu that selects the method of the desired SOAP webservice.
Parameters: Set parameters for the desired SOAP webservice based on the method selected from the WSDL.

  • Parameter: The parameter name. The module automatically populates this field when selecting a method for the desired SOAP webservice.
  • Value: The value to be submitted for the parameter. This field accepts dynamic variables from within an application.

Module Settings

  • Hold Music
  • Timeout Length (default setting 30 seconds)
  • Private
  • Show Custom Errors
Setting notes

Set hold music in the application settings.
The two common errors associated with a SOAP webservice are timeouts and faults. The latter are custom SOAP errors.

modules/soap.1487250078.txt.gz · Last modified: 2017/02/16 08:01 by admin